Hello, I'am not sure if I understood what you want to do, but, If you want to change files mp3, wm or wav to a wav files format used by 4400/OXE, I didit with Goldwave. With GoldWave:
1) Open a valid wav file (with alcatel format)
2) Erase al the content of the file (sounds). It will erase the information of the file and will keep the 4400/OXE format sound formats.
3) Open (in another windows) the mp3 files (for example) that you want to convert to 4400/OXE format.
4) Copy the content of the mp3 file and pasted on the firts opened wav file (the open file at step 1)
5) Save the file with the name you want to.
6) And thats all, Now you will have the mp3 file converted to valid wav 4400/OXE file without loose quallity.
